Package org.geotools.gml3.complex
Class GmlFeatureTypeRegistryConfiguration
Object
GmlFeatureTypeRegistryConfiguration
- All Implemented Interfaces:
FeatureTypeRegistryConfiguration
public class GmlFeatureTypeRegistryConfiguration
extends Object
implements FeatureTypeRegistryConfiguration
Feature Type Registry Configuration for GML. Depending on the schema type different version of GML class may be
called upon. eg
GML
or GML
- Author:
- Victor Tey, CSIRO Exploration and Mining, Niels Charlier
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ionstatic Configuration
findGmlConfiguration
(Configuration configuration) getId()
boolean
isFeatureType
(XSDTypeDefinition typeDefinition) boolean
isGeometryType
(XSDTypeDefinition typeDefinition) boolean
isIdentifiable
(XSDComplexTypeDefinition typeDefinition) void
setEmptyNamespace
(XSDTypeDefinition typeDefinition)
-
Constructor Details
-
GmlFeatureTypeRegistryConfiguration
-
-
Method Details
-
getSchemas
- Specified by:
getSchemas
in interfaceFeatureTypeRegistryConfiguration
-
getConfigurations
- Specified by:
getConfigurations
in interfaceFeatureTypeRegistryConfiguration
-
getAbstractFeatureType
-
getAbstractGeometryType
-
getNameSpace
-
getId
-
setEmptyNamespace
public void setEmptyNamespace(XSDTypeDefinition typeDefinition) -
isFeatureType
public boolean isFeatureType(XSDTypeDefinition typeDefinition) - Specified by:
isFeatureType
in interfaceFeatureTypeRegistryConfiguration
-
isGeometryType
public boolean isGeometryType(XSDTypeDefinition typeDefinition) - Specified by:
isGeometryType
in interfaceFeatureTypeRegistryConfiguration
-
isIdentifiable
public boolean isIdentifiable(XSDComplexTypeDefinition typeDefinition) - Specified by:
isIdentifiable
in interfaceFeatureTypeRegistryConfiguration
-
findGmlConfiguration
-